Prestonpans station provides essential services despite its modest size. Although there is no traditional ticket office, ticket machines are available, enabling travelers to conveniently collect tickets purchased online. These machines are fully accessible, ensuring ease of use for all passengers. The station is also equipped with induction loops to support passengers with hearing impairments, although it lacks staff for on-site support. For passenger safety, CCTV cameras monitor the premises.
Accessibility is well considered at Prestonpans. Step-free access is available to parts of the station, accommodating those who might find mobility challenging. The station boasts a generous car park with 165 spaces, including 11 designated Blue Badge spaces, offering free access—all covered by CCTV to ensure your peace of mind.
However, it's worth noting that the station lacks certain facilities such as toilets and refreshment points. This makes it essential to plan accordingly, especially on longer journeys. Despite these limitations, travelers can take solace in the seating areas provided, a comfortable spot to wait for your train.
Prestonpans station is a hub of connectivity, allowing seamless transitions to other modes of transport. For those looking to continue their journey by bus, local services can be accessed easily via Gardiner Terrace. Travelers can find details about bus schedules on Traveline Scotland or by calling their 24-hour hotline.
If you need a taxi, many are available for hire through TrainTaxi, ensuring you have no trouble continuing your journey from the station. While there are no immediate cycle hire facilities, bicycle storage is well-catered for with 22 available spaces.

Kentish Town West station, while small, offers essential services for a hassle-free travel experience. The ticket office, though only open from 07:30 to 10:00 on weekdays, is complemented by accessible ticket machines available for purchasing and collecting tickets. This ensures that your journey starts smoothly, and the induction loop facilities further aid those needing audio assistance.
While the station offers step-free access to the street level, it's essential to note that there is no step-free access to the platforms, making it prudent for travelers with mobility needs to plan accordingly. Despite the lack of waiting rooms or refreshment facilities, basic needs such as payphones are readily accessible, making Kentish Town West a no-frills yet practical station.
Connected with a range of transport options, Kentish Town West ensures you can travel easily. Should there be disruptions, rail replacement services conveniently operate with bus stops located at Malden Road for eastbound journeys, and on Prince of Wales Road for westbound trips.
